Description:

Reporting to the Manager CareCoord&SocalSvcs, Social Services, this position coordinates care and service for defined patient populations across the acute care continuum. This includes discharge planning, utilization management, care coordination, and support for resource utilization. This position works collaboratively with an interdisciplinary team to improve patient care through the effective utilization of the facility's resources. The incumbent makes significant contributions toward achievement of desired clinical, financial, and resource utilization outcomes.

Requirements

1. High school diploma or equivalent is required. A degree from an accredited baccalaureate nursing program is preferred.

2. Current licensure as a Registered Nurse in the state of California is required.

3. Current American Heart Association (AHA) Healthcare Provider CPR card is required.

4. Certified Case Manager (CCM) national certification is preferred.

5. Experience with two (2) areas of clinical specialty is preferred.

6. Excellent communication skills, critical thinking, creative problem-solving skills, and competent organizational and planning skills are required.

7. The incumbent must be self-directed and able to tolerate frequent interruptions with a demanding workload.

8. Knowledge regarding hospital protocol and procedures, clinical standards and outcomes, funding options, familiarity with community resources and outside professional agencies, familiarity with federal and state regulations governing hospital and home care, as well as understanding of the financial structure of health plan and delivery system is preferred.

What We Do

Trinity Health is one of the largest not-for-profit, Catholic health care systems in the nation. It is a family of 115,000 colleagues and nearly 26,000 physicians and clinicians caring for diverse communities across 25 states. Nationally recognized for care and experience, the Trinity Health system includes 88 hospitals, 131 continuing care locations, the second largest PACE program in the country, 125 urgent care locations and many other health and well-being services. Based in Livonia, Michigan, its annual operating revenue is $20.2 billion with $1.2 billion returned to its communities in the form of charity care and other community benefit programs.
